Bis-aryl triazoles as selective inhibitors of 11beta-hydroxysteroid dehydrogenase type 1.

Abstract

3-Aryl-5-phenyl-(1,2,4)-triazoles were identified as selective inhibitors of 11beta-hydroxysteroid dehydrogenase type 1 (11beta-HSD1). They are active in both in vitro and an in vivo mouse pharmacodynamic (PD) model. The synthesis and structure activity relationships are presented.
